PARK NAME: Bohemian Switzerland

Country: Czechia

Park ID: 979

AVERAGE RATING: 64/100

Review Volume: Low number of reviews

DESCRIPTION:
Bohemian Switzerland features dramatic sandstone rock formations and deep gorges carved by the Elbe River. The park is known for its iconic Pravčická brána, the largest natural sandstone arch in Europe. Dense forests and unique microclimate create habitats for diverse flora and fauna.

PARK NAME: Krkonoše

Country: Czechia

Park ID: 980

AVERAGE RATING: 58/100

Review Volume: Low number of reviews

DESCRIPTION:
Krkonoše is the highest mountain range in Czechia, featuring the peak Sněžka at 1,603 meters. The park contains unique arctic-alpine tundra ecosystems above the tree line. Its diverse landscape includes glacial cirques, alpine meadows, and spruce forests.

PARK NAME: Podyjí

Country: Czechia

Park ID: 981

AVERAGE RATING: 55/100

Review Volume: Low number of reviews

DESCRIPTION:
Podyjí National Park protects the deep valley of the Dyje River and surrounding forests. The park features dramatic meanders, rocky outcrops, and diverse microclimates supporting unique plant species. It forms a continuous protected area with Austria's Thayatal National Park.

PARK NAME: Šumava

Country: Czechia

Park ID: 982

AVERAGE RATING: 63/100

Review Volume: Low number of reviews

DESCRIPTION:
Šumava is the largest national park in Czechia, protecting a mountain range along the German and Austrian borders. The park features pristine mountain forests, peat bogs, glacial lakes, and mountain meadows. It is home to rare species including lynx, capercaillie, and black grouse.
